Essentials
Daily Budget
R800–1,500 (~€45–85) / day
per person · excl. accommodation
Main Airport
Cape Town International Airport (CPT)
~25 min to city · Bolt/Uber ~R250–350 · Airport Shuttle ~R180
Search flights to Cape TownVisa
Visa-free for EU, UK, US up to 30–90 days
Tipping
10–15% at restaurants · tip service staff generously
Vlogger Tip
Hike up Table Mountain early — gates open at 8AM and trails get crowded by 10AM. If the tablecloth cloud rolls in, go to Boulders Beach for the penguins instead.

FAQ
Cape Town is generally safe in tourist areas like the Waterfront, Gardens, and Camps Bay. Avoid walking alone at night in unfamiliar neighborhoods and use Bolt/Uber instead of street taxis.
EU, UK, US, Canadian, and Australian citizens can visit South Africa visa-free for 30–90 days depending on nationality. Always check current requirements before travel.
The South African Rand (ZAR) is the currency. Cards are widely accepted in tourist areas, restaurants, and shops. Carry some cash for markets and small vendors.
Table Mountain is the iconic flat-topped mountain overlooking the city. You can hike up (2–3 hours) or take the rotating cable car. Go early morning to avoid crowds and check the weather — it closes in strong winds.
About 70km south of the city, a 1–1.5 hour drive. Most visitors combine it with Boulders Beach penguin colony and Chapmans Peak in a full-day Peninsula tour.
The V&A Waterfront is great for families and first-timers. Gardens/De Waterkant are popular with boutique travelers. Camps Bay offers beach access and a lively atmosphere.
